<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??碼云GVP開源項目 12k star Uniapp+ElementUI 功能強大 支持多語言、二開方便! 廣告
                ~~~ FTP服務器配置 Wu-FTP:古老,配置復雜 Proftp:功能強大 vsftp:安全,高速,穩定 系統默認ftp軟件 啟動:/etc/rc.d/init.d/vsftpd start (默認啟動后即支持用戶宿主目錄訪問及匿名訪問) 注意:如果上傳文件,要注意宿主目錄的權限,否則會上傳失敗 配置文件:/etc/vsftpd/vsftpd.conf 安裝vsftp [root@localhost test]# rpm -q vsftpd package vsftpd is not installed [root@localhost test]# yum install vsftpd [root@localhost test]# rpm -q vsftpd vsftpd-2.2.2-11.el6_4.1.i686 [root@localhost test]# service vsftpd start 為 vsftpd 啟動 vsftpd: [確定] 安裝啟用后,默認就可以訪問了 ftp 172.17.18.3 匿名訪問設置 //允許匿名登錄,默認訪問為ftp用戶宿主目錄 anonymous_enable=YES //激活上傳和下載日志 xferlog_enable=YES xferlog_std_format=YES xferlog_file=/var/log/xferlog //設置歡迎信息 ftpd_banner=Welcome to Sam is FTP service,enjoy it. //設置匿名用戶最大傳輸速率為100KB/s anon_max_rate=100000 匿名FTP用戶名:ftp anonymous 密碼:密碼為空 ftp偽用戶宿主目錄 /var/ftp 常用ftp命令: 如沒安裝ftp組件,可以 yum install ftp ftp FTP地址 ftp> ls - 查看目錄下文件 cd - 切換目錄 bin - 二進制傳輸 lcd - 切換下載目錄(本地) get - 下載單個文件 mget - 下載多個文件 put - 上傳單個文件 mput - 上傳多個文件 prompt - 關閉交互模式 bye - 退出 open - 連接FTP服務器 user - 輸入FTP服務器用戶名和密碼 編寫自動下載腳本 [root@localhost ftp]# cat auto.ftp open 172.17.18.3 user ftp adsd@123.com bin prompt lcd /ftp.bak mget * bye //執行自動下載-n是關閉操作ftp時,調用命令行的模式 [root@localhost ftp]# ftp -n < auto.ftp 用戶訪問設置 //允許用戶登錄 local_enable=yes write_enable=yes local_umask=022 //用戶最大傳輸速率為200KB/s local_max_rate=200000 若啟用SELinux允許用戶上傳文件到宿主目錄,執行命令: setsebool -P ftp_home_dir 1 setsebool -P allow_ftpd_full_access 1 *關閉SELinux,編輯/etc/selinux/config 用戶訪問控制 限制指定的用戶不能訪問,而其他用戶可以訪問: userlist_enable=yes usrlist_deny=yes userlist_file=/etc/vsftpd.user_list 限制指定的用戶可以訪問,而其他用戶不可以訪問: userlist_enable=yes userlist_deny=no userlist_file=/etc/vsftpd.user_list //編輯,每個用戶占一行 [root@localhost ftp]# vi /etc/vsftpd.user_list 1 mary 2 jack [root@localhost ftp]# service vsftpd restart 關閉 vsftpd: [確定] 為 vsftpd 啟動 vsftpd: [確定] //沒授權的用戶禁止登錄 [root@localhost ftp]# ftp 172.17.18.3 Connected to 172.17.18.3 (172.17.18.3). 220 Welcome to blah FTP service. Name (172.17.18.3:root): fukedi 530 Permission denied. Login failed. //授權的用戶可以登錄 [root@localhost ftp]# ftp 172.17.18.3 Connected to 172.17.18.3 (172.17.18.3). 220 Welcome to blah FTP service. Name (172.17.18.3:root): mary 331 Please specify the password. Password: 230 Login successful. Remote system type is UNIX. Using binary mode to transfer files. cd 可以切換到其它目錄,這是因為目錄具有rx權限 比如:cd / 可以切換到根目錄訪問 可以通過以下設置,禁止用戶切換到別的目錄,只能訪問自己的宿主目錄 修改/etc/vsftpd/vsftpd.conf chroot 在ftp用戶把宿主目錄當作/目錄 //設置所有用戶執行chroot chroot_local_user=YES //設置指定的用戶不執行chroot chroot_local_user=YES chroot_list_enable=YES chroot_list_file=/etc/vsftp/chroot_list [root@localhost ftp]# vi /etc/vsftpd/chroot_list 1 mary 用戶切換到其它目錄,一般只有rx權限,如需對這個目錄有寫權限,只需改變這個目錄的所有者為該用戶即可,chown 用戶名 目錄 其它選項 //用戶會話空閑10分鐘后被掛斷 idle_session_timeout=600 //服務器的總的并發連接數為50 max_clients=50 //每個客戶機的最大連接數為3 max_per_ip=3 //指定非標準端口 listen_port=10021 ftp默認端口是21 [root@localhost ftp]# grep ftp /etc/services ftp-data 20/tcp ftp-data 20/udp # 21 is registered to ftp, but also used by fsp ftp 21/tcp ftp 21/udp fsp fspd [root@localhost ftp]# ftp 172.17.18.3 10021 Connected to 172.17.18.3 (172.17.18.3). 220 Welcome to blah FTP service. Name (172.17.18.3:root): //指定掃描端口范圍 [root@localhost ftp]# nmap -p 1-65535 172.17.18.3 Starting Nmap 5.51 ( http://nmap.org ) at 2014-05-06 22:07 CST Nmap scan report for 172.17.18.3 Host is up (0.000012s latency). Not shown: 65529 closed ports PORT STATE SERVICE 22/tcp open ssh 111/tcp open rpcbind 3306/tcp open mysql 10000/tcp open snet-sensor-mgmt 10021/tcp open unknown 55013/tcp open unknown ~~~
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看